About Bird Rock

The reef at Bird Rock drops from 5m to 40m plus. There are plenty of caves and swim throughs to explore along its plummeting wall.

Bird Rock Dive Info: Key Characteristics and Details

Unit Settings

Terrain and Features: Wall, Drop Off
Entry Type:-
Max Depth:40m
Visibility Range:13m - 38m
Experience Level:Advanced
Best Gas:21% - 28% O2

Marine Life

  • Bump Head Wrass
  • Sea Perch
  • Coral Trout
  • Anemone Fish
  • Red Bass
  • Hard Corals
  • Grey Reef Sharks
  • Paddle-Tail Snappers
  • Nudibranchs
